Folks, the Source Hunter DLC pack is just a means of getting some of the Digital Collector's Edition benefits for people who already owned the game on Steam (i.e. Steam Early Access backers). Steam doesn't allow people to purchase the same game for their own account twice, so this DLC pack was the only way for SEA backers to "upgrade" to the Digital Collector's Edition (which only became available at a later date).

It was something we requested and Larian was kind enough to oblige us. It's not them trying to push DLC on people on day one.

I think it contains some extra compared to just Kickstarter stuff. First of all the bonuses you get from Kickstarter depended on your pledge amount, so if you didn't pledge $50 or more, you didn't get all the goodies (sound track, concept art etc.). Second it contains the bonus item you get by registering Divinity Anthology.

It doesn't contain any additional missions or stuff like that. Just two in-game items that afaik are just funny, not useful.
